Size: a a a

QA — Автоматизация

2020 September 15

А

Айдар in QA — Автоматизация
Oleg
Обращаетесь к вебдрайверу до его инициализации.
Thread.sleep попробовать добавить?
источник

O

Oleg in QA — Автоматизация
Нет
источник

O

Oleg in QA — Автоматизация
Инициализировать драйвер )
источник

А

Айдар in QA — Автоматизация
Oleg
Нет
Просто он кидает Session ID is null по середине теста
источник

А

Айдар in QA — Автоматизация
А не в начале
источник

O

Oleg in QA — Автоматизация
Значит таки закрываете его.
источник

А

Айдар in QA — Автоматизация
два шага,
And chosen sub_user verifies that all features from permission_list are present on the main page
And chosen sub_user verifies that permission that are not allowed for this user, are not present.
источник

А

Айдар in QA — Автоматизация
после первого шага кидает Null Session ID
источник

А

Айдар in QA — Автоматизация
хотя эти шаги идентичны
источник

А

Айдар in QA — Автоматизация
почему не кидает во время первого шага
источник

А

Айдар in QA — Автоматизация
я тестирую в 4х браузерах, у первого браузера все хорошо, а вот после 1го у всех одно и тоже
источник

O

Oleg in QA — Автоматизация
Айдар
я тестирую в 4х браузерах, у первого браузера все хорошо, а вот после 1го у всех одно и тоже
Ну ошибка говорит о том, что вебдрайвер Вы закрыли/не открыли. Смотрите в коде почему так происходит.
источник

А

Айдар in QA — Автоматизация
но после первого шага, я ничего не закрываю, уже 12ый час пытаюсь смотреть
источник

А

Айдар in QA — Автоматизация
ничего не могу найти
источник

D

D in QA — Автоматизация
Айдар
у меня есть фреймворк, Page Object Model,  через cucumber написал features files, в step-defenitions имплементировал их, в фиче есть шаг:
Given user is on the login page with "<browser>"
через этот шаг запускается WebDriver,  но еще в самом Page образе запускается драйвер, но сейчас проблема в том что выходит ошибка
NoSuchSessionException: Session ID is null. Using WebDriver after calling quit()?
на шаге где я не вызываю WebDriver
У вас запускается два драйвера?
источник

А

Айдар in QA — Автоматизация
D
У вас запускается два драйвера?
По идее нет
источник

А

Айдар in QA — Автоматизация
Все по очереди
источник

А

Айдар in QA — Автоматизация
Первый хром
источник

D

D in QA — Автоматизация
Что значит фраза «через этот шаг запускается WebDriver,  но еще в самом Page образе запускается драйвер» тогда?
источник

D

D in QA — Автоматизация
Выглядит будто у вас инициализирован новый инстанс драйвера, для которого производятся действия, по запущен другой инстанс
источник